Ericsson hit with Canadian grid penalty

Marcus Ericsson has been slapped with a three-place grid drop for the Canadian GP for crashing into his team-mate in Monaco. Battling for position around the Monte Carlo streets, Felipe Nasr was ordered by Sauber to move over for his team-mate. The Brazilian decided not to. This prompted Ericsson to make a lunging move, down the inside at Rascasse, one that cost the Sauber drivers as both cars were left in need of repairs. Nasr retired a lap later, saying there was 'smoke' in his cockpit, while Ericsson parked his C35 shortly after.
